A RESOLUTION COMMENDING AND CONGRATULATING GEORGE COUNTY HIGH SCHOOL SENIOR PITCHER/OUTFIELDER WENDELL FAIRLEY FOR BEING NAMED TO THE 2007 LOUISVILLE SLUGGER PRESEASON ALL-AMERICAN HIGH SCHOOL TEAM.

     WHEREAS, George County High School Senior Wendell Fairley has been named to the prestigious Louisville Slugger 2007 Preseason All-American High School First Team; and

     WHEREAS, Wendell Fairley, Senior Pitcher, Outfielder and Slugger for the George County "Rebels," has signed with the University of Southern Mississippi and is also a football standout.  He was also one of just two Mississippians to be named a first-team, All-American, with Catcher Cody Freeman of West Lauderdale High School being the other; and

     WHEREAS, Wendell was named to the Dandy Dozen by The Clarion-Ledger with the following statistics:  five-tool player, Mississippi's top pro-prospect and was a First Team All-State selection by The Clarion-Ledger last season; batted .451, including 7 doubles, 6 triples, 6 home runs and 31 RBIs for the Rebels; on the mound, compiled a 5-4 record with 68 strikeouts and a 2.07 ERA in 50 innings; and also a football standout; and

     WHEREAS, "Sometimes you get a good athlete that can play baseball, but Wendell is a good athlete who is actually a baseball player," says George County Coach Ronnie Powell; and

     WHEREAS, Lucedale, Mississippi, usually lures football recruiters by producing high-profile wide receivers.  Wendell Fairley, who also plays football on the side (he played Quarterback and Receiver this past season), stuck to his first love of baseball.  Scouts project that Fairley could be drafted in the first five rounds of the Major League draft in June; and

     WHEREAS, this is the 11th year Louisville Slugger has sponsored high school All-American teams.  The squad was chosen by the staff of Collegiate Baseball and the athletes were honored in the January 26 edition of the newspaper; and

     WHEREAS, it is with great pride that we recognize this achievement by a student athlete who has brought honor to his school, his community and to the State of Mississippi:

     N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E SENATE OF THE STATE OF MISSISSIPPI, That we do hereby commend and congratulate George County High School Senior Pitcher/Outfielder Wendell Fairley for being named to the 2007 Louisville Slugger Preseason All-American High School First Team, and extend to him the best wishes of the Senate for success in his collegiate career and future endeavors.
